Hello,

I do a simple read on the SPI2 of a dsPIC30F6014A.
No way to get it run - the read value is always 0x00.

Here is the code snippet of some settings:
Code:

/*                                                 */
/* global header                                    */
/* YUM                                             */
/* global.h, 06/11                                    */
/* compile with CCS - 4.119, MPLAB 8.76                     */


#include   <30F6014A.h>
#device *=16 adc=12

// due to a silicon bug of the PIC processor, the fuses are set manually:
#FUSES 1=0x8705
#FUSES 2=0x003F
#FUSES 3=0x87A3
#FUSES 4=0x310F
#FUSES 5=0x330F
#FUSES 6=0x0007
#FUSES 7=0xC003

#ZERO_RAM


#define VERSION 0x0611
#define Fosc 40000000

#ID VERSION
#TYPE  SHORT=8, INT=16, LONG=32
#USE FIXED_IO(a_outputs=PIN_A6, PIN_A7, PIN_A9, PIN_A10, PIN_A13, PIN_A14, PIN_A15)
#USE FIXED_IO(b_outputs=PIN_B2, PIN_B3, PIN_B5, PIN_B6, PIN_B7, PIN_B8, PIN_B9, PIN_B10, PIN_B11, PIN_B14)
#USE FIXED_IO(c_outputs=PIN_C1, PIN_C2, PIN_C3, PIN_C4)
#USE FIXED_IO(d_outputs=)
#USE FIXED_IO(f_outputs=PIN_F6, PIN_F8)
#USE FIXED_IO(g_outputs=PIN_G6, PIN_G8, PIN_G9, PIN_G15)
#USE delay(clock = Fosc)
#use rs232(baud=9600, UART1, parity=N,bits=8)[b]




Here is the code snippet of the subroutine:

Code:
//------------------------------------------------------------------------
// read the keypad
char up_key_read_the_keypad(void)
 {
 char read_value;
 setup_spi2(spi_master | SPI_MODE_0 |spi_clk_div_128 | SPI_MODE_8B);
 CS_KEY_OFF();
 CS_KEY_ON();
 delay_us(10);
 read_value = spi_read2(0xf3);
 delay_us(10);
 CS_KEY_OFF();

printf("  read value: %02X\r\n", read_value);

 return read_value;
 }
/*---------------------------------------------------------*/




Here is the screenshot of the signals and the serial test-output:



As you can see, all signals are present; the serial input (miso) is NOT static 0,
but most of the time 1
, so changing the spi modes will not help.
The spi is even running very slowly.

Any ideas?

I don't see SPI_MODE_0 defined in your code, thus I wonder what's missing else. But there's no obvious reason, why spi_read2 should read 0x00 with the shown waveforms, provided you connected the right SDI2 pin.
